The Union Gospel Mission is a resource dedicated to fighting homelessness and addiction by providing a range of services and programs. It offers meals, safe shelter, clean clothing, and recovery programs to those in need. The organization aims to transform lives by demonstrating the love of Christ to the less fortunate. Through rehabilitation and job training programs, the Union Gospel Mission helps individuals to rebuild their lives and reintegrate back into the community. Their mission is driven by faith, hope, and love, and they strive to provide holistic solutions to homelessness and addiction.
